What Separates a Genuine Sportsbook Review Site from the Rest
The integrity of a sportsbook review site can significantly influence a bettor’s journey, especially for those new to online wagering. With countless websites claiming to offer impartial reviews, it becomes imperative to know which ones truly serve the user’s best interest. At its core, a legitimate sportsbook review platform adheres to transparent evaluation standards. These standards typically include criteria such as licensing status, market coverage, odds competitiveness, transaction security, user interface design, customer support quality, and adherence to responsible gambling practices. Trustworthy sites not only list these parameters clearly but also explain how each sportsbook scores in these areas. One critical aspect of credible review platforms is editorial independence. While many review sites operate on affiliate partnerships, genuine ones clearly disclose such relationships and ensure they do not influence review outcomes. Instead of ranking sportsbooks solely by commission value, reputable sites prioritize user safety, long-term satisfaction, and factual accuracy. Another differentiator is update frequency. A strong review platform regularly revisits sportsbooks to track changes in terms, odds formats, bonus structures, and user complaints. This dynamic approach ensures that bettors aren’t relying on outdated or irrelevant information. Community interaction is also a strong indicator of quality—platforms that invite user reviews, foster discussion, and encourage feedback create a space where bettors can learn from each other’s experiences. Additionally, a trustworthy review site provides educational resources such as betting guides, odds calculators, and terminology breakdowns, all of which empower users to engage in informed and responsible betting. Together, these elements form a foundation of credibility, making the difference between a superficial directory and a truly dependable betting ally.
